Book excerpt: The thalamus plays a critical role in perceptual processing, but many questions remain about what thalamic activities contribute to sensory and motor functions. In this book, two pioneers in research on the thalamus examine the close two-way relationships between thalamus and cerebral cortex and look at the distinctive functions of the links between the thalamus and the rest of the brain. Countering the dominant "corticocentric" approach to understanding the cerebral cortex—which does not recognize that all neocortical areas receive important inputs from the thalamus and send outputs to lower motor centers—S. Murray Sherman and R. W. Guillery argue for a reappraisal of the way we think about the cortex and its interactions with the rest of the brain. The book defines some of the functional categories critical to understanding thalamic functions, including the distinctions between drivers (pathways that carry messages to the cortex) and modulators (which can change the pattern of transmission) and between first-order and higher-order thalamic relays—the former receiving ascending drivers and the latter receiving cortical drivers. This second edition further develops these distinctions with expanded emphasis throughout the book on the role of the thalamus in cortical function. An important new chapter suggests a structural basis for linking perception and action, supplying supporting evidence for a link often overlooked in current views of perceptual processing.

Available in PDF, EPUB and Kindle. Book excerpt: The thalamus is often described as a relay. Typified by sensory pathways, this concept leads to thalamic nuclei being viewed as areas that passively streams information from a single source to the cortex, without affecting the nature of that information. However, diverse intrathalamic connections, the varying synaptic and membrane properties of thalamic neurons and the large number of inputs from non-sensory sources make the idea that the thalamus is just a passive relay unlikely. Furthermore, a large number of thalamic nuclei are not primarily driven by sensory signals nor do they exclusively target the cortex, meaning the thalamus must do more than simply pass sensory signals to the cortex. Finally, there is a wealth of research demonstrating that the thalamus does indeed function in ways that are not captured by the concept of a simple relay. So why, given all of this, is the primary paradigm for describing the thalamus, a relay? This Research Topic covers original research, reviews and hypotheses on thalamic function that explore the concept that the thalamus performs computational tasks other than simply passively relaying information.

Available in PDF, EPUB and Kindle. Book excerpt: Cognitive processing is commonly conceptualized as being restricted to the cerebral cortex. Accordingly, electrophysiology, neuroimaging and lesion studies involving human and animal subjects have almost exclusively focused on defining roles for cerebral cortical areas in cognition. Roles for the thalamus in cognition have been largely ignored despite the fact that the extensive connectivity between the thalamus and cerebral cortex gives rise to a closely coupled thalamo-cortical system. However, in recent years, growing interest in the thalamus as much more than a passive sensory structure, as well as methodological advances such as high-resolution functional magnetic resonance imaging of the thalamus and improved electrode targeting to subregions of thalamic nuclei using electrical stimulation and diffusion tensor imaging, have fostered research into thalamic contributions to cognition. Evidence suggests that behavioral context modulates processing in primary sensory, or first-order, thalamic nuclei (for example, the lateral geniculate and ventral posterior nuclei), allowing attentional filtering of incoming sensory information at an early stage of brain processing. Behavioral context appears to more strongly influence higher-order thalamic nuclei (for example, the pulvinar and mediodorsal nucleus), which receive major input from the cortex rather than the sensory periphery. Such higher-order thalamic nuclei have been shown to regulate information transmission in frontal and higher-order sensory cortex according to cognitive demands. This Research Topic aims to bring together neuroscientists who study different parts of the thalamus, particularly thalamic nuclei other than the primary sensory relays, and highlight the thalamic contributions to attention, memory, reward processing, decision-making, and language. By doing so, an emphasis is also placed on neural mechanisms common to many, if not all, of these cognitive operations, such as thalamo-cortical interactions and modulatory influences from sources in the brainstem and basal ganglia. The overall view that emerges is that the thalamus is a vital node in brain networks supporting cognition.

Book excerpt: ‘Connectivity and Functional Specialization in the Brain’ is a topic that describes nerve cells in terms of their anatomical and functional connections. The term connectome refers to a comprehensive map of neural connections, like a wiring diagram of an organism’s nervous system. Connectomics, the study of connectomes, can be applied to individual neurons and their synaptic connections, as well as to connections between neuronal populations or to functional and structural connectivity of different brain regions. This book addresses neural connectivity at these various scales in health and disease.
